The French-born museum director joins the Miami Beach institution from a seven-year stint as the director at the <a class=\"transition-all duration-default shadow-internalLink hover:text-red-1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.theartnewspaper.com\/keywords\/museu-de-serralves\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Serralves Museum of Contemporary Art<\/a> in Porto, where he led the institution&#8217;s expansion with its \u00c1lvaro Siza Wing, inaugurated in 2024.<\/p>\n<p class=\"pt-dp-p font-text-light font-light text-lg leading-normal tracking-wide mb-base last:mb-0\" itemprop=\"text\">\u201cThe Bass and Serralves have many similarities, such as both being Art Deco buildings and having extensions designed by Pritzker-winning architects,\u201d Vergne tells The Art Newspaper, referring in the Bass Museum\u2019s case to Pritzker Prize-winning architect Arata Isozaki\u2019s 1995 concept for the institution&#8217;s campus in Collins Park.<\/p>\n<p class=\"pt-dp-p font-text-light font-light text-lg leading-normal tracking-wide mb-base last:mb-0\" itemprop=\"text\">After decades of executive roles at institutions including the Museum of Contemporary Art in Los Angeles, the Dia Art Foundation in New York and the Walker Art Center in Minneapolis, Vergne says his latest move reflects his current priority, which is to be more active as a curator. \u201cIt became clear to me that I reached a moment where I want to prioritise working with artists and communities,\u201d he says.<\/p>\n<p class=\"pt-dp-p font-text-light font-light text-lg leading-normal tracking-wide mb-base last:mb-0\" itemprop=\"text\">Vergne\u2019s past curatorial accolades include co-organising the 2006 edition of the Whitney Biennial with Chrissie Iles and curating solo exhibitions of artists including Kara Walker, Yves Klein and Mike Kelley at different institutions.<\/p>\n<p class=\"pt-dp-p font-text-light font-light text-lg leading-normal tracking-wide mb-base last:mb-0\" itemprop=\"text\">The moment is also right for Bass Museum, where Vergne will succeed former chief curator James Voorhies. The conversations between Vergne and the museum\u2019s executive director Silvia Karman Cubi\u00f1\u00e1, who are old friends, started over a phone call and, after a few months of back-and-forth, the museum decided to craft a new position which also spans the artistic director role. \u201cWe\u2019ve developed this job description for Philippe in an organic way because he has a long history of working on artist commissions and oversee projects from scratch,\u201d Karman Cubi\u00f1\u00e1 says.<\/p>\n<p class=\"pt-dp-p font-text-light font-light text-lg leading-normal tracking-wide mb-base last:mb-0\" itemprop=\"text\">Vergne sees ample synchrony between his and Karman Cubi\u00f1\u00e1\u2019s visions for the Bass. \u201cWe are both fans and champions of similar artists,\u201d he says, citing as an example the Puerto Rico-based artist duo Allora &amp; Calzadilla, which is featured in the Bass\u2019scollection and was the subject of an <a class=\"transition-colors duration-default shadow-externalLink hover:text-red-1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.serralves.pt\/en\/ciclo-serralves\/alloracalzadilla-entelechy\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">exhibition at the Serralves<\/a> in 2023. The museum is in the early stages of an expansion that will turn a 22,000-sq.-ft parking lot into new permanent collection galleries, an outdoor patio and an event space. In April, the museum <a class=\"transition-all duration-default shadow-internalLink hover:text-red-1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.theartnewspaper.com\/2026\/04\/14\/bass-museum-miami-beach-expansion-architects-johnston-marklee\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">selected<\/a> the Los Angeles-based architecture firm Johnston Marklee to design the new pavilion, which will be funded in part through <a class=\"transition-all duration-default shadow-internalLink hover:text-red-1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.theartnewspaper.com\/2022\/11\/10\/bass-museum-municipal-bond-20m-miami-beach-midterm-election-new-wing\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">$20.1m in city-issued funds<\/a> as part of a municipal bond authorised by local voters in 2022.<\/p>\n<p class=\"pt-dp-p font-text-light font-light text-lg leading-normal tracking-wide mb-base last:mb-0\" itemprop=\"text\">\u201cI\u2019ve been privileged to accumulate over the years the chance to rub shoulders with great practitioners, mentors and architects in different expansions, including my first director role at the Mus\u00e9e d\u2019Art Contemporain in Marseille in 1992,\u201d he Vergne says. \u201cA new architectural form gives an institution a new mission and I am happy to be able to continue this experience.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"pt-dp-p font-text-light font-light text-lg leading-normal tracking-wide mb-base last:mb-0\" itemprop=\"text\">The Bass\u2019s current exhibitions include a survey of <a class=\"transition-all duration-default shadow-internalLink hover:text-red-1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.theartnewspaper.com\/2025\/12\/01\/must-see-shows-south-florida-miami-art-week-2025\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Jack Pierson\u2019s photography<\/a> and a presentation of Douglas Gordon and Philippe Parreno\u2019s 2006 film piece <a class=\"transition-colors duration-default shadow-externalLink hover:text-red-1\" href=\"https:\/\/thebass.org\/art\/zidane-a-21st-century-portrait\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Zidane: A 21st Century Portrait<\/a> (until 19 July) timed to coincide with the 2026 Fifa World Cup.
